The Natural Beauty of Florianópolis
Florianópolis is renowned for its breathtaking landscapes that range from dramatic beaches to lush forests. A significant highlight is the Lagoinha do Leste, a secluded beach paradise accessible through a picturesque trek or a boat ride. This pristine location offers stunning vistas and an unspoiled environment, perfect for those who crave isolation and natural beauty.
Another must-see is Praia Mole, famous for its long stretch of golden sand and clear waters, offering an ideal spot for surfing and sunbathing. The flora and fauna surrounding the area add an enchanting touch, providing several opportunities for nature walks and wildlife spotting. Explore the stunning Lagoa da Conceição for its serene waters and lush green surroundings, offering various water activities such as windsurfing and kayaking.
Cultural and Historical Richness
Florianópolis boasts a rich tapestry of history and culture. Visit the Ribeirão da Ilha, one of the oldest districts, where you can walk through charming streets with traditional Azorean architecture. This neighborhood offers a glimpse into the city’s cultural roots with several historical landmarks, including the Igreja Nossa Senhora da Lapa.
The city’s commitment to preserving its history can also be seen at the Fortaleza de São José da Ponta Grossa. This historic fortress offers panoramic views and is a reminder of the island’s strategic importance in past conflicts. Walking through these historical sites provides not just a glimpse into the past but an appreciation of how the local culture has evolved.
Adventure and Urban Thrills
Floripa is also a haven for adventure seekers. For an adrenaline rush, try sandboarding on the dunes of Joaquina Beach or hiking the challenging trails of Morro da Cruz for a breathtaking bird’s eye view of the island. The cityscape offers ample urban adventures with vibrant nightlife in the Lagoa neighborhood, which is sure to impress.
For shopping enthusiasts, the diverse markets and boutiques provide a blend of local handicrafts and modern fashion. These venues, such as the public market, offer excellent opportunities to engage with locals and appreciate the artisanal skills passed down through generations.

Main Tourist Attractions
Florianópolis is home to an array of attractions that highlight its natural beauty and cultural richness. Here are some must-visit spots:
Attraction | Description | Highlight | Category |
---|---|---|---|
Praia Mole | A vibrant beach known for its golden sands and great surf. | Beautiful scenery and vibrant nightlife. | Nature & Adventure |
Joaquina Beach | Famous for its strong waves and sand dunes, perfect for surfing. | Beautiful dunes and excellent surfing conditions. | Adventure & Nature |
Centro Historico de Florianópolis | The historic center showcasing traditional Azorean architecture. | Cultural richness and beautiful architecture. | Culture & History |
Ilha do Campeche | A stunning island offering beautiful beaches and hiking trails. | Great for snorkeling and exploring nature. | Nature & Adventure |
Mercado Público | A lively market featuring local food, crafts, and music. | Authentic local experiences and tastes. | Culture & Food |
Parque Estadual do Rio Vermelho | A preserved area with rich biodiversity and scenic trails. | Ideal for eco-tourism and bird watching. | Nature |
Local Experiences: Food, Culture, and Festivals
Florianópolis is not only about its scenic beauty but also about its vibrant culture and culinary delights. The city’s gastronomy is a reflection of its coastal location and cultural heritage.
Don’t miss out on the chance to savor local specialties like sequência de camarões (shrimp sequence) and pastel de fruto do mar (seafood pastry). Beyond its culinary offerings, Florianópolis hosts numerous festivals throughout the year that celebrate its culture, such as the Festa do Pôr do Sol, where locals and visitors gather to watch the sunset while enjoying music and snacks.
